Big C focuses on amino recovery signaling, while creatine monohydrate increases phosphocreatine availability for faster ATP regeneration during repeated high-intensity efforts. Together, they cover both the energy side of hard training and the recovery side between sessions.
Take creatine daily anytime; use Big C around training
Big C is leucine-centered, but maximal muscle protein synthesis still depends on access to the full essential amino acid spectrum. Pairing it with a fast-digesting protein source gives the leucine signal the complete amino raw material it needs to translate into actual repair and growth.
Use Big C pre- or post-workout; take whey post-workout or to fill protein gaps
If you want a more complete intra- or peri-workout amino strategy, EAAs complement Big C by supplying the essential amino acids that BCAA-only systems do not cover. This is especially useful during cutting phases or fasted training when total amino availability is lower.
Use Big C pre-workout and EAAs during training
Because Big C is stim-free and recovery-focused, it stacks cleanly with a separate pre-workout for energy, focus, nitric oxide support, or endurance. This lets you build a more customized system instead of relying on one overloaded formula to do everything.
Take both 20-30 minutes pre-workout

Magnum Big C is a capsule-based amino recovery formula built around one central idea: preserve muscle, accelerate repair signaling, and improve training continuity by saturating the formula with leucine-centered BCAA support from multiple delivery forms. This is not a typical flashy pre-workout or a generic low-dose BCAA drink. It is a more old-school but still physiologically relevant anti-catabolic design that emphasizes the branched-chain amino acids most directly involved in muscle protein signaling, exercise recovery, and fatigue management.
The anchor here is leucine and leucine-related compounds. Free-form L-leucine is the primary amino acid trigger for mTOR activation, the pathway that initiates muscle protein synthesis. Clinical literature consistently places effective leucine dosing around 2.5-5g, but Magnum does not disclose the individual amounts of free leucine or the leucine ethyl ester HCl. That matters. The mechanism is strong and the evidence base is excellent, but without exact milligrams, the clinical assessment is necessarily limited. The same transparency issue applies to L-isoleucine, L-valine, and their ethyl ester HCl forms. Isoleucine contributes to glucose uptake in muscle and energy handling during training, while valine helps support nitrogen balance and can reduce central fatigue by competing with tryptophan transport across the blood-brain barrier. Together, the three BCAAs work better as a system than in isolation, and this formula clearly leans into that synergy.
The ethyl ester forms are a notable formulation choice. In theory, esterification increases lipophilicity and improves membrane passage before esterases cleave the compound back into the free amino acid. That rationale is plausible and widely used in formulation design, especially for improving transport characteristics, but the direct human performance data on leucine, isoleucine, and valine ethyl esters is still emerging rather than definitive. In practical terms, this means Big C is designed to provide both immediate free-form amino availability and a modified delivery component, but the exact advantage over free-form-only systems remains more theoretical than conclusively proven.
The most transparent high-value inclusion is L-leucine alpha-ketoisocaproate calcium at 1,000mg. KIC is a leucine metabolite often used in anti-catabolic formulas because it sits downstream of leucine metabolism and has been studied for reducing muscle breakdown and supporting recovery under intense training stress. At 1,000mg, it is meaningfully dosed and gives Big C a distinct identity beyond a basic BCAA capsule. Glycine-L-arginine at 1,000mg adds an arginine donor role, supporting nitric oxide production and blood flow physiology, though it sits below the more common standalone arginine research range of 2-4g taken multiple times daily. It is best understood here as a supporting ingredient rather than the primary reason to buy the formula.
The B-vitamin panel is modest: niacin 3mg, vitamin B6 0.3mg, vitamin B12 0.7mcg, and folic acid 50mcg. These are not performance-driving doses, but they do contribute basic cofactor support for amino acid metabolism and energy pathways.
From a transparency perspective, Big C is mixed. It is not a proprietary blend in the classic sense, but several of the most important amino ingredients do not have individual disclosed amounts. That prevents a full milligram-by-milligram clinical audit. Still, the formula strategy is clear: use multiple leucine-centered BCAA forms plus KIC to create a recovery-focused, anti-catabolic capsule product.
What should you expect? On day 1, not much in the way of a dramatic sensation. This is not a stimulant product. What you notice is more likely downstream: slightly less muscle breakdown, better session-to-session resilience, and smoother recovery when used consistently around training and paired with adequate total daily protein. Over 2-4 weeks, the value becomes clearer for lifters training with enough intensity and volume to actually need amino support between sessions.
Leucine is the primary branched-chain amino acid trigger for mTORC1 activation in skeletal muscle, making it the most important amino acid for initiating post-exercise muscle protein synthesis. Its signaling role is distinct from simply serving as substrate, because leucine functions as a nutrient-sensing cue that shifts muscle toward repair and rebuilding. This is why leucine thresholds matter in peri-workout and meal-based recovery design. In practice, formulas centered on leucine are most relevant when training stress is high or protein feeding is imperfect.
Alpha-ketoisocaproate, or KIC, is a direct metabolite of leucine formed during branched-chain amino acid transamination. Mechanistically, KIC has been studied for its ability to support nitrogen economy and reduce aspects of exercise-related protein breakdown, giving it a more anti-catabolic identity than standard BCAA-only products. It does not replace leucine's signaling role, but may complement it by influencing breakdown-side physiology. That makes it especially interesting in calorie deficits or repeated high-volume training blocks.
Big C combines free-form branched-chain amino acids with ethyl ester derivatives, reflecting an older but still conceptually relevant delivery strategy. Free-form amino acids have clearer evidence for direct availability, while esterified forms were designed to potentially alter membrane passage and transport behavior. The evidence base for these modified forms is less established than for standard amino acids, but the formulation logic is to broaden delivery characteristics rather than rely on a single form. From a design perspective, this makes the product more specialized than a basic BCAA capsule.
Arginine-containing compounds are often included for circulation, nitrogen handling, and recovery-related support, though outcomes depend heavily on form and dose. Glycine-L-Arginine may contribute to a more supportive amino environment around training rather than creating a strong acute performance sensation. At 1,000mg, it is better viewed as a complementary recovery component than the primary driver of the formula. Its main value is in rounding out the product's anti-breakdown and repair-support positioning.
